There is an exciting new arrival at Arrow Equestrian – the first Racewood Equine Simulator in the county! The simulator has been  custom  made  with a realistic  canter and gallop and a  head and neck  which moves with the stride. It has sensors on its sides and on the bit  so you can regulate the speed with your legs and reins or you can control it by  pressing the buttons on its shoulder.  The adjustable girth straps allow  you  to use any saddle, (dressage, jumping or racing) and it will carry  a vaulting roller – ideal for  improving suppleness, balance and confidence.

This is a fantastic teaching aid as the instructor can make “hands on” adjustment to rider’s positions while the simulator is moving. In addition, the video cameras set up around the horse enables you to see yourself  on the  TV monitor while you are riding.

Sue Nevill-Parker who owns Arrow Equestrian says:
“I find that canter is the best pace in which to learn how to achieve a balanced supple seat and to be able to keep cantering uninterrupted for as long as you like makes all the difference. The slowest pace is very relaxing and therapeutic and gives the novice rider a gentle introduction to canter. It is also useful for making fundamental changes to your riding before consolidating them at the faster speeds.  The middle pace is as close to a working canter as you can get without actually being on a real horse and is equally useful  for  dressage and  jumping.  The fastest pace is for racing or cross country and everyone who has tried it has found it challenging but exhilarating  – ideal for getting fit.
